Athens Police Search for Westside Peeping Tom

The offender is said to have no facial hair and possibly no hair on his head.

From August 2 until September 13, Athens Clarke County Police believe there have been at least five cases of peeping tom on and near Westchester Drive, according to a story in the Athens Banner Herald. There may have been more incidents that were detected.

The same slim, light-skinned colored black man has been seen outside people's homes. In one case, he was naked from the waist down and performing a sex act on himself, the story says. In another, he exposed himself to a woman and her children.

And police also believe, the story says, that the man went into a woman's house and touched her, then ran away when she screamed.

There is now a $1,000 reward because police believe he may escalate his behavior and commit an assault, the story says.
